Lawrence Butler, born on October 7th, 2000 in Burlington, New Jersey, is a talented professional baseball player known for his skills as a corner outfielder. Despite being born in New Jersey, Lawrence grew up in the Atlanta, Georgia area where he lived with his family. It was in this vibrant and sports-loving environment that Lawrence's passion for baseball was ignited.
Lawrence's journey to becoming a professional baseball player started when he was drafted by the Oakland Athletics during the sixth round of the 2018 MLB Draft. This was a major milestone for the young athlete, as he was selected from Westlake Public High School in Atlanta, Georgia.
